Adams free will sacrifice is not like Adams sin. Adam is said to be Like one of The Us, Genesis 3:22. And Moses is a type of Christ, A prophet like unto me... Deuteronomy 18:15.

What evil did he know and what good did he do for us? Why did he not substitute himself for Eve?

It's important to look at Moses when you discuss Adam. Moses has the woman Israel and Adam has the woman Eve. Israel and Eve are deceived by the same lie and both bring destruction upon themselves. Adam is put into a deep sleep... think death. Moses is in a deep sleep on the mount of Ephraim. Christ is preaching in a loud voice from the cross and then just as fast as you can drop a light switch He gives up His life.

We now are in the two trees. God, by putting the blood covering of skins on them makes it impossible to go to the second tree and be condemned to death forever.
